About the Tournament

The cost of entry is as follows: a $500 boat and registration fee for up to 4 members, plus an extra $100 per each 2-night non-angler pass (all with a potential $100 late fee if entering later than June 15 each year). As for when to register and how, keep in mind that you’d fill out the form online, which you can find on the Ron Hoover Fishing Tournament’s website. Alternatively, you can print it out and fill it out manually, and then send it by mail. Remember to register by June 15 if you want to be included!
The whole event kicks off on Friday, July 29th, which is technically day 1 and registration day. Make your way to the South Padre Island Convention Center (lots of parking nearby!), from which on-site check-in and registrations start promptly at 5 p.m. and run until 8 p.m. Also, from 6 to 8 p.m., they have Heavy Hors D’oeuvres sponsored by Starcraft. So, if you’re hungry for a quick bite, make sure not to miss that. There’s also a Kevin Fowler Live Concert running from 7 to 9 as well as a mandatory captains’ meeting from 7 to 7:30.
If you get up early the next day, you can fish plenty: it’s open fishing from 6 a.m. to 2 p.m. To weigh the fish you’ve caught, head over to Jim’s Pier anytime from noon to 2. You must be already standing in line by 2. They make no exceptions to this rule, so be sure to be there before the cutoff! The convention center reopens at 5:30 that same evening to begin with the awards ceremony and dinner (starting at 6, offering great appetizers, a main course and dessert). There will be comedians, door prizes and a grand award prize! The whole event ends around 9 that night.

Guided Division
This division can have up to 3 members in each group participating, as opposed to the non-guided, which can have up to 4. With the cost being the same as that listed above, each member participating will get their full share of all the following (all included in that $500 price): full dinner for both nights, a concert ticket, admittance to the comedy show, and up to 4 raffle tickets per team for a chance to win either the Majek M2 or the Viking RV, up to 5 tickets to win a door prize, plus a bag that is loaded with other convenient goodies. Only anglers in the division can actually enter the event at that price, and any friends or family members not actively participating but coming on as guests of those participating in the Guided Division would be required to pay the additional price of a “social ticket” at whatever the vendor lists it for on the day of the event. Charitable Giving
It’d be a crime not to speak to this: the portion of the proceeds going to Make A Wish. A great chunk of the final proceeds of the Ron Hoover Fishing Tournament will go toward helping kids who battle with unfortunate health conditions, mainly those residing within the beautiful nearby Rio Grande Valley. It’s been estimated that this powerhouse non-profit philanthropy agency grants a child’s wish approximately every half hour (or about every 34 minutes, to be more precise). They have been around since the ‘80s and now hold over 40,000 different volunteers across the country, each making a proud difference in the lives of the ill, from their little own corner of America. Any young one between 2 and 18 years of age is a prime candidate for their help — they specialize in helping those in this age group who battle with everything from brain tumors to liver failures. More than 300,000 recorded wishes have been granted thus far, a numerical record the agency plans to break each year.
